8. 路由器和交换机的配置与管理技术
发布时间: 2024-02-26 14:41:00 阅读量: 35 订阅数: 31
# 1. 网络设备概述
## 1.1 路由器与交换机的作用和区别
网络中的路由器和交换机是两种常见的网络设备,它们在网络通信中扮演着重要的角色。路由器主要负责在不同网络之间进行数据包的转发,实现不同网络之间的通信;而交换机则主要负责在同一网络中进行数据包的转发,实现局域网络内计算机之间的通信。
**路由器和交换机的区别:**
- 路由器工作在网络层,具有跨网络的路由功能;而交换机工作在数据链路层,主要负责局域网内部的数据交换。
- 路由器能够实现不同网络之间的通信,具有网络隔离的功能;交换机则主要用于同一网络内部的设备通信,提供更快速的数据交换。
- 路由器具有较强的网络策略控制能力,能够进行网络地址转换等复杂的数据处理;交换机主要负责数据包转发,速度更快,但功能相对简单。
## 1.2 不同类型的路由器和交换机介绍
在网络设备中,路由器和交换机有多种类型,根据功能和规模的不同,可以分为不同种类的设备。常见的路由器和交换机类型包括:
- 企业级路由器和交换机:通常拥有更强大的处理能力和安全性能,适用于大中型网络环境。
- SOHO路由器和交换机:主要用于小型办公室或家庭网络,功能简单易用,适合小规模网络环境。
- 无线路由器和交换机:具有无线网络功能的设备,可以实现有线和无线设备的连接。
## 1.3 运行原理和基本组成部分
路由器和交换机的运行原理和基本组成部分如下:
- **路由器运行原理:** 路由器通过查找路由表,确定数据包的传输路径,实现不同网络之间的数据转发。
**基本组成部分:** 路由器由控制平面和转发平面组成,控制平面负责路由协议运行和路由表更新,转发平面负责数据包的实际转发。
- **交换机运行原理:** 交换机通过学习MAC地址表,实现局域网内部设备之间的数据包转发。
**基本组成部分:** 交换机包括多个端口、交换矩阵、MAC地址表等组件,通过学习和转发数据帧来实现设备间通信。
在接下来的章节中,我们将深入探讨如何配置和管理路由器与交换机,以及优化网络设备性能和未来发展趋势。
# 2. 路由器的配置与管理
路由器在网络中扮演着至关重要的角色,它负责将数据包从一个网络传输到另一个网络。本章将介绍路由器的配置与管理技术,包括基本设置、静态路由与动态路由配置、路由器的安全配置以及SNMP管理与路由器监控。
#### 2.1 路由器的基本设置
在配置路由器之前,首先需要进行基本的设置,包括设置主机名、管理IP地址、密码等。下面是一个基本的路由器配置示例(使用Cisco设备作为示例):
```shell
Router> enable
Router# configure terminal
Router(config)# hostname R1
R1(config)# interface GigabitEthernet0/0
R1(config-if)# ip address 192.168.1.1 255.255.255.0
R1(config-if)# no shutdown
R1(config-if)# exit
R1(config)# enable secret MySecretPassword
R1(config)# exit
R1# copy running-config startup-config
```
这段代码中,首先通过`enable`命令进入特权模式,然后使用`configure terminal`命令进入全局配置模式。接着设置了路由器的主机名为R1,并配置了接口GigabitEthernet0/0的IP地址为192.168.1.1。最后设置了特权模式下的密码,并且保存了配置。这样就完成了基本的路由器设置。
#### 2.2 静态路由与动态路由配置
路由器可以通过静态路由和动态路由两种方式来进行路由表的配置。静态路由需要手动配置路由信息,适用于网络规模较小且拓扑结构稳定的情况;而动态路由能够根据网络的实际情况自动更新路由表,适用于网络规模较大或者拓扑结构频繁变化的情况。
静态路由配置示例(继续使用Cisco设备作为示例):
```shell
Router(config)# ip route 10.0.0.0 255.0.0.0 192.168.1.2
```
动态路由配置示例(使用OSPF协议作为示例):
```shell
Router(config)# router ospf 1
Router(config-router)# network 192.168.1.0 0.0.0.255 area 0
```
#### 2.3 路由器的安全配置
保护路由器的安全是网络管理中的重要任务之一。路由器的安全配置包括密码设置、访问控制列表(ACL)的配置、管理平面安全等。特别是要注意对路由器的远程管理进行安全限制,避免未授权访问。
密码设置示例:
```shell
Router(config)# enable password MyEnablePassword
Router(config)# enable secret MySecretPassword
Router(config)# username admin privilege 15 secret MyAdminPassword
```
ACL配置示例:
```shell
Router(config)# access-list 1 permit 192.168.1.0 0.0.0.255
Router(config)# interface GigabitEthernet0/0
Router(config-if)# ip access-group 1 in
```
#### 2.4 SNMP管理与路由器监控
Simple Network Management Protocol(SNMP)是一个网络管理协议,用于收集管理信息、修改设备配置、监控网络性能等。路由器可以通过
0
0